Schuylkill River National Heritage Area
Summary
In June, the Schuylkill River National Heritage Area hosted its 19th annual Schuylkill River Sojourn. Organized around the theme "I Protect the Schuylkill River," this year's Sojourn drew 220 paddlers from 12 states, 70 of which completed the entire 112-mile journey from Schuylkill Haven to Philadelphia's Boathouse Row. Throughout the Sojourn, paddlers experienced noon and evening programs aligned with the watershed preservation theme at stops in historic river towns, trailheads and riverfront parks along the Schuylkill River Trail.
